ION is seeking a Product Manager to oversee the Clarus Data product globally. The role involves managing the strategic roadmap, enhancing customer relationships, and identifying new revenue streams within the OTC derivatives data space.
Ideal candidates will have 5-10 years of experience in OTC capital markets, strong communication and project management skills, while also having the ability to write insightful blogs. Proficiency in Excel and Python is preferred, and understanding regulatory impacts is essential.
